United Way of Manatee County will celebrate “Live United Week” later this month and is asking East County residents to support the cause.

First up will be a “Giving Back to School Days” — a three-day volunteer blitz to help ready several schools for the coming year.

Volunteers will tackle projects such as cleaning, landscaping and organizing at Lincoln Middle and Mills, Rowlett, Able, Palma Sola, Wakeland, Blackburn, Bayshore and Rodgers elementary schools July 22 through July 24. For information or to sign up, contact Doreen Ravagnani at [email protected] or call 748-1313.

Next, United Way will launch its annual fundraising campaign with a kick-off breakfast at 7:30 a.m. July 25, at Renaissance on 9th, 1816 Ninth St. W., Bradenton. The event will be held in conjunction with the Manatee Chamber of Commerce Coffee Club event.

And, lastly, the organization is asking individuals to use their voice, share stories and show their support by following United Way on Facebook and Twitter, to help advocate for individuals in need.
